Lakeridge is 2-8 against Lake Oswego since October of 2016 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Friday. The Pacers will look to defend their home field against the Lakers at 7:00 p.m. Both squads will be entering this one on the heels of a big victory.
On Friday, Lakeridge took their game with ease, bagging a 35-7 victory over Tigard. Given the Pacers' advantage in MaxPreps' Oregon football rankings (they are ranked fourth, while the Tigers are ranked 36th) , the win wasn't entirely unexpected.

Lakeridge's win was the result of several impressive offensive performances. One of the most notable came from Drew Weiler, who threw for 166 yards and four touchdowns while completing 71.4% of his passes. Weiler's passing game has become a key predictor of the Pacers' success: the team is undefeated when his passer rating is 100 or higher, but only 2-3 otherwise. Another pass catcher making a difference was Turner Tropio, who picked up 81 receiving yards and three TDs.
Lakeridge didn't let much get past them through the air: they limited Tigard to a completion percentage of just 42.1%. The Pacers weren't nearly as limited: they posted one of 68.8%.
Meanwhile, Lake Oswego never let their opponents score on Friday. They breezed past Oregon City to the tune of 48-0. The Lakers haven't had any issues with the Pioneers recently, as the game was their fourth consecutive win against them.
Lake Oswego's victory bumped their record up to 7-1. As for Lakeridge, their win bumped their record up to 5-3.
Lakeridge came up short against Lake Oswego in their previous meeting back in November of 2024, falling 28-18. A big factor in that loss was the dominant performance of the Lakers' LaMarcus Bell, who rushed for 165 yards and a pair of scores.
